AMERISAFE Inc. is a specialty insurance provider that focuses exclusively on workers' compensation coverage for small and mid-sized businesses in high-hazard industries including construction, logging, trucking, and manufacturing. It operates across 49 U.S. states, offering tailored insurance policies paired with targeted risk management support for clients.

VINCE. is a contemporary clothing fashion brand founded in 2002. In 2023 Authentic Brands Group purchased its intellectual property in a $76.5 million deal.
